Dictionaries
English
English
Русский
Sign In
Sign Up
English
English
Russian
Russian
English
Russian
Narrow alley
Translation narrow alley into russian
narrow alley
узкая аллея
He walked down the narrow alley to reach the main street.
Он прошел по узкой аллее, чтобы добраться до главной улицы.
Translations